Go Hotel City

The Go Hotel City is perfectly situated for travelers arriving in Copenhagen, with easy access to both the airport and the metro station. It's located in a quiet neighborhood, yet still within walking distance of grocery stores and a few local dining spots—great for convenience without sacrificing peace. I arrived early, and while my room wasn’t ready, the hotel offered a secure locker service for storing luggage at a small fee—very helpful for early arrivals. The room itself was compact but clean and well-designed for solo travelers; it might feel a bit tight for two guests. One thing worth noting: there’s no air conditioning in the room. While this may be common in Denmark, it did get quite warm during the day. Since I was on the ground floor, I felt uneasy leaving the window open for ventilation. Still, despite that minor drawback, my stay was pleasant overall. The staff were friendly, the space was tidy, and the location made everything easy. I’d definitely consider staying here again on my next trip to Copenhagen.

Wakeup Copenhagen - Bernstorffsgade

Stayed at Wakeup Copenhagen - Bernstorffsgade for three nights during my trip to Copenhagen, and overall it was a great experience. The room is small but thoughtfully designed—plenty of storage space with cleverly built-in shelves, making it easy to organize luggage. One thing to note: the hotel doesn’t offer free luggage storage, and larger suitcases don’t fit well in the limited space. However, there’s a nearby hostel called Next House just next door, where you can store bigger bags for only 20 DKK—a smart and affordable solution. Location-wise, it’s super convenient for getting around the city by metro, and the vibe of the place feels modern yet cozy. Definitely a solid choice if you're looking for a clean, budget-friendly stay in central Copenhagen.
